- Description
Currently, Tiki creates a single RSS feed per feature (e.g., wiki, articles, etc.).
For features that support i18n, this means that end-users will subscribe to a feed that contains items that they cannot read.
It would be nice if Tiki could create language-specific feeds each feature.
You can see this on info.t.o; we issue articles in English and French and Tiki includes both languages in a single feed: http://info.tiki.org/tiki-articles_rss.php?ver=2
- Solution
On the Admin: Feeds page (tiki-admin.php?page=rss) add an option: Generate language-specific feeds (prerequisite = multilingual option).
If enabled Tiki will:
- Create a unique feed for each language/feature. For example, http://info.tiki.org/tiki-articles_rss.php?ver=2&lang=en or http://info.tiki.org/tiki-articles_rss.php?ver=2&lang=fr
- Use the site's defined Default language if the RSS URL does not contain the lang option. For example, http://info.tiki.org/tiki-articles_rss.php?ver=2 would show English only (if the site's default language is EN).
